Transaction 184f66b431709716039101101d98c22f0693f5d64684c220acb30b33280667a0
1 Input
1 Output
-
184f66b431709716039101101d98c22f0693f5d64684c220acb30b33280667a0:0
- value
- 5417328
- script pubkey
- OP_0 OP_PUSHBYTES_20 f56afc3ab55d23a5aa5e84a39a7f0501a80c70e6
- address
- bc1q7440cw44t536t2j7sj3e5lc9qx5qcu8xwfe526